Jellybean is a microcontroller platform based on the LPC43xx. It is designed
|
||||
to control Lemondrop.
|
||||
|
||||
hardware notes:
|
||||
|
||||
Schematic and layout files were designed in KiCad, an open source electronic
|
||||
design automation package.
|
||||
|
||||
order of copper layers:
|
||||
Front
|
||||
Inner3
|
||||
Inner2
|
||||
Back
|
||||
|
||||
PCB description: 4 layer PCB 1.6 mm
|
||||
Copper 1 35 um
|
||||
Dielectric 1-2 0.35 mm
|
||||
Copper 2 18 um
|
||||
Dielectric 2-3 0.76 mm
|
||||
Copper 3 18 um
|
||||
Dielectric 3-4 0.35 mm
|
||||
Copper 4 35 um
|
||||
DE104iML or equivalent substrate (Er=4.42@2.4GHz TanD=0.016)
|
||||
double side solder mask black
|
||||
double side silkscreen white
|
||||
6 mil min trace width and
|
||||
6 mil min isolation
|
